In this blog post, we will share 10 tips on how you can incorporate eco-friendly practices into your fashion choices. By making small changes, we can all contribute to a more sustainable future. 1. Choose Organic Fabrics: Opt for clothing made from organic materials such as organic cotton, hemp, or bamboo. These fabrics are grown without the use of harmful chemicals and pesticides, making them better for the environment and your skin. 2. Buy Second-Hand: Consider shopping at thrift stores, consignment shops, or online platforms for second-hand clothing. Not only will you find unique pieces, but you will also reduce the demand for new clothing production, which has a significant environmental impact. 3. Invest in Quality: Instead of buying cheap, fast-fashion items that quickly wear out, invest in high-quality, durable pieces that will last longer. This reduces the need for frequent replacements and minimises waste. 4. Embrace Minimalism: Adopt a minimalist approach to your wardrobe by focusing on versatile, timeless pieces that can be mixed and matched. This reduces the need for excessive consumption and helps create a more sustainable closet. 5. Repair and Upcycle: Instead of discarding damaged clothing, learn basic sewing skills to repair them. You can also get creative and upcycle old garments into new items or accessories. This not only saves money but also reduces waste. 6. Wash with Care: Wash your clothes in cold water and use eco-friendly detergents. Air-dry your t-shirts and hoodies whenever possible to save energy and extend their lifespan. Avoid using the dryer, as it consumes a significant amount of electricity. 7. Support Sustainable Brands: Research and support brands that prioritise sustainability and ethical practices. Look for certifications such as Fair Trade, G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ard), or B Corp to ensure that your purchases align with your values. 8. Rent or Borrow: For special occasions or one-time events, consider renting clothing instead of buying new. There are many rental services available that offer a wide range of stylish options. You can also borrow clothes from friends or family for a fresh look without the environmental impact. 9. Say No to Fast Fashion: Avoid the allure of fast fashion trends that encourage disposable clothing. Instead, focus on building a timeless and sustainable wardrobe that reflects your personal style. 10. Spread the Word: Share your knowledge and passion for sustainable eco-friendly fashion with others. Encourage friends and family to make conscious choices and support eco-friendly brands. By spreading awareness, we can create a larger impact and inspire others to join the movement.
